Variables Influencing University Rankings:.
The ranking of Leading Ranked Colleges in Uganda and throughout East Africa is identified by numerous factors, including:.
Academic Track Record: Based on surveys of academics and companies.
Company Reputation: Mirroring the top quality of graduates and their employability.
Faculty/Student Proportion: Showing the level of tailored interest students get.
Research Study Citations per Professors: Gauging the effect of study output.
International Faculty Ratio: Reflecting the diversity and worldwide point of view of the institution.
International Trainee Ratio: Indicating the university's appearance to worldwide students.
These metrics, usually made use of by worldwide ranking agencies, provide a thorough analysis of a university's performance and credibility. Nevertheless, it's essential to acknowledge that rankings are simply one aspect to take into consideration when choosing a university.
Challenges and Opportunities:.
Despite the progress made, Colleges in Uganda and East Africa encounter a number of difficulties, consisting of:.
Funding Constraints: Limited financing can impede infrastructure growth and research activities.
Quality Control: Guaranteeing regular quality across all programs and establishments.
Relevance to Industry Needs: Lining up curricula with the demands of the labor market.
Access and Equity: Broadening access to college for marginalized groups.
However, there are also significant chances for growth and development, consisting of:.
Boosted Government Financial Investment: Governments are identifying the relevance of higher education and increasing their investment.
Private Sector Partnerships: Partnerships with the private sector can enhance research and technology.
Regional Combination: Strengthening local partnerships can improve the top quality and competitiveness of colleges.
Technical Innovations: Leveraging modern technology to enhance mentor and discovering.
